Is there experience/reports of using voxelotor in sickle cell patients who are Jehovah Witnesses with few crises but who have fatigue and/or dyspnea?
1 Answers
Mednet Member
Hematology · Boston University School of Medicine
I would not hesitate to use voxelotor in most patients with sickle cell anemia, including Jehovah's Witnesses, if they have not responded to hydroxyurea with near cessation of acute vasoocclusive events and have continued hemolytic anemia.
